#a8a408 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a8a408 is composed of 65.9% red, 64.3%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.4% magenta, 95.2%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 58.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 34.5%. #a8a408 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ff10 with #514900.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#a8a408

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#121201 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a8a408

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5d52 is the less saturated color, while #afaa01 is the most saturated one.
